The NYC BigApps Jobs and Economic Mobility Hackathon will feature great prizes (to be announced soon!) for teams that participate and demo apps that improve underserved New Yorkers' access to work and economic opportunity.
We will also help people form teams and provide expert advisors to answer programming, design, and Jobs and Economic Mobility questions.
Partners of the event include the Blue Ridge Foundation, Robin Hood Foundation, and Coatue Foundation. The event will be hosted by SVA.
NYC BigApps is the City’s premier open data software competition. Over the last three years of the competition, over 235 free web and mobile applications have been created from over 750 City data sets, winning over $100,000 in prizes. This year we are offering $150,000 in cash prizes and many other exciting changes, including a focus on BigIssues. Read more at NYCBigApps.com
